摘要
建立了浸入式固相微萃取-气相色谱法(IM-SPME-GC-MS)测定葡萄酒挥发性成分的方法,并对萃取条件和色谱条件进行了优化;对宁夏贺兰山东麓地区赤霞珠葡萄酒挥发性成分进行了测定。该方法简便、快速、精确,适合葡萄酒挥发性较强成分的测定;分离鉴定了葡萄酒中20种主要挥发性成分,其中异戊醇、乙酸乙酯、D,L-2,3-丁二醇、内消旋-丁二醇、琥珀酸二乙酯、醋酸、2-羟基丙酸乙酯、苯乙醇等物质占主要比例。
The detection of volatile constituents in grape wine by IM-SPME-GC-MS had been developed and the extraction conditions and chromatography conditions were optimized. Furthermore, the method was used to determine the volatile constituents in cabernet sauvignon grape wine made in Helanshan Ningxia. The method was simple, rapid, and accurate and especially suitable for the detection of components of strong volatility in grape wine. More than 20 kinds of volatile constituents were isolated from grape wine and identified as follows (the main constituents): isoamyl alcohol, ethyl acetate, D,L-2,3-butanediol, internal compensation- butanediol, diethyl succinate, acetic acid, 2-ethyl hydracrylic acid, and phenethyl alcohol etc.
